Celebrate and Learn About the Value of Our Oceans on World Oceans Day!





June 8th is World Oceans Day!

Did you know our oceans cover 70% of the Earth? This important part of our biosphere is a major source of oxygen, food and some of the coolest animals on the planet!

The ocean connects, sustains, and supports us all—but its health is at a tipping point. As the past years have shown us, we need to work together to create a new balance with the ocean that no longer depletes its bounty but instead restores its vibrancy and brings it new life.

XAVIER RIDDLE AND THE SECRET MUSEUM

Explore the ocean floors and find sea cucumbers, salmon, kelp, and more with Xavier, Yadina, Brad, and Rachel Carson!

Rachel Carson is an American marine biologist, author, and conservationist whose writings are credited with advancing the global environmental movement.

“It is a curious situation that the sea, from which life first arose should now be threatened by the activities of one form of that life. But the sea, though changed in a sinister way, will continue to exist; the threat is rather to life itself.”

—Rachel Carson
